š Handmade with Core Design Technique
This bead was crafted using the core design technique, a meticulous method where finely crushed recycled glass is poured into hand-carved molds. Artisans from the Krobo region expertly insert design elements made from different colored glass powders before firing the bead in outdoor kilns. This āmold-inlaidā method has been passed down for generations and reflects the creativity and identity of Ghanaās Krobo people.
These Ghana glass beads have played a vital role as currency and cultural symbols throughout African history. Revered as recycled beads, powder glass beads, or Old Gashi beads, they remain powerful expressions of artistry and tradition.
